Question

If p, q, r are statements with truth values T, T, F respectively determine the truth values of the following.

(p ∧ q) → ∼ p.

Sum
Advertisements

Solution

(p ∧ q) → ∼ p ≡ (T ∧ T) → ∼ T 

≡ T  → F

≡ F.

Hence, truth value is F.
